Here are the 5 ecology questions that we discussed in class today. You will likely see one or more of these on your exam!
Questions to Ponder
1. How have advancements in agriculture and industry changed demands on ecosystems?
2. From an energy economy point of view, is it better to have a mixed diet, or to be a vegetarian?
3. Do you think it will be possible for technology to allow for longer food chains to exist?
4. How would a pyramid of energy for a prairie community differ from summer to winter?
5. Why is an ecosystem with high biodiversity more stable than one with a low biodiversity?
